eCommerce Test Analyst

Tryzens Limited is an international digital agency and our mission is to accelerate client success and growth across all channels, leveraging our expertise, insights, and digital-first principles, to deliver compelling experiences that delight and engage their customers.

With headquarters based in London and a proven development centre at Trivandrum, India, a near-shore office at Sofia in Bulgaria, at Melbourne, Sydney in Australia and at Indianapolis in USA. Our areas of expertise include the delivery of digital solutions (eCommerce and non-commerce), multi-channel retail solutions, and project management amongst others. We provide best-of-breed solutions and services to several blue-chip clients primarily within retail, financial services, and other industries. We have built our delivery-focused reputation upon technical innovation, in-depth business knowledge, and creative vision, all of which support our objective of helping clients to gain true value from digital solutions. We have a platform-neutral independent approach working with the world’s leading technology partners Salesforce, SAP Commerce, Adobe Commerce, Shopify, OpenCart, WooCommerce, BigCommerce, CommerceTools and Middleware.

 We are looking for Senior Test Analyst with experience in testing ecommerce applications to join our QA team at our Trivandrum office in India.

  • 1-3 years of experience in Testing.
  • Experience in testing ecommerce websites.
  • Experience in API Testing.
  • Experience in Mobile App testing.
  • Platform knowledge il Salesforce, SAP Commerce, Adobe Commerce, Shopify, OpenCart, WooCommerce, BigCommerce, CommerceTools and Middleware- Mulesoft, Patchworks , Payment Integration testing, OMS, Automation-Playwright
  • Good understanding of QA processes and methodologies – test planning, test cases, bug tracking systems and various software development lifecycles.
  • Understanding of Web technologies: HTTP(S), Web Services (SOAP, RESTful), HTML/CSS/JS.
  • Understanding of performance testing/accessibility testing principles and best practices.
  • Knowledge in e-commerce principles such as: SEO, Web Analytics, Page builder etc.

Preference will be given to candidates with:

  • Understanding of performance testing/accessibility testing principles and best practices.
  • Programming skills in one of the following languages: JAVA, Python, PHP, JavaScript and understanding of OOP principles, data structures, etc.
  • Knowledge in some key internet and e-commerce principles such as: SEO, Web Analytics, Geotargeting, etc.

Common Interview Questions for eCommerce Test Analyst
What steps do you usually take to ensure the quality of an e-commerce application?

To ensure the quality of an e-commerce application, I follow a structured testing process that includes requirement analysis, test case design, and execution. I focus on functional testing, UI testing, API testing, and performance testing to comprehensively identify any issues. Throughout this process, I communicate regularly with developers and stakeholders to address concerns and implement solutions efficiently.

Can you explain your experience with API testing in e-commerce applications?

My experience with API testing specifically involves validating the functionality and security of various APIs used in e-commerce platforms. I utilize tools like Postman to send requests and analyze responses, ensuring that API integrations function as expected. I also focus on edge cases and error-handling to guarantee that the application remains robust under all circumstances.

What tools and technologies have you used for testing e-commerce websites?

I have experience working with various testing tools such as Selenium for automated UI testing, Postman for API testing, and Apache JMeter for performance testing. Additionally, I have utilized bug tracking tools like Jira and test management tools like TestRail to document results and monitor testing progress effectively.

What do you know about the importance of SEO in e-commerce testing?

SEO is essential in e-commerce testing because it directly impacts the visibility and accessibility of a website. My testing process includes verifying that on-page SEO elements such as title tags, meta descriptions, and image alt texts are correctly implemented. I also assess site speed and mobile responsiveness, as these factors influence search engine rankings and user experience.

What are some key performance metrics you focus on while testing e-commerce applications?

While testing e-commerce applications, I focus on key performance metrics such as page load times, time to first byte, and responsiveness across various devices. I also monitor conversion rates and error rates in user transactions, as these metrics inform how well the application meets user needs and can impact overall sales and user retention.
